This book was a compelling read. Definitely a page turner for me. If you don’t want to read about specifics about the Holocaust, you have come to the wrong place. And if you expect a fully accurate telling, you have come to the wrong place. It is as accurate as makes sense and achieves what it set out to do: tells the beautiful love story of a man and woman who met under horrible circumstances. Definitely a page turner.
